Solaris 8 07/01 installation : Fast Data Access MMU Miss

807559Nov 13 2001
hello,

Because of a hardware crash of my 9.1Gb hard drive, I plugged a brand new 40Gb drive in my Ultra 10 workstation.
I tried to re-install my release of Solaris 8 (06/00), but this release detect only a 5Gb hard drive (but the installation work).
I downloaded and burned Solaris 8, release 07/01 to break the 32Gb/drive limit, but when I type 'boot cdrom' or 'boot cdrom install' at the bios prompt, I get :
Fast Data Access MMU Miss.

I upgraded the PROM to the lastest version, and tried to reburn the CD.

Does someone has any idea to help me ?
